Amazon Black Howler vs Bush Pipit

Alouatta nigerrima compared with Anthus caffer

Taxonomic Classification

Rank Amazon Black Howler Bush Pipit
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um same Chordata (Chordates) Chordata (Chordates)
Class Mammalia (Mammals) Aves (Birds)
Order Primates (Primates) Passeriformes (Songbirds)
Family Atelidae Motacillidae
Genus Alouatta Anthus
Species Alouatta nigerrima Anthus caffer

Evolutionary Relationship

Amazon Black Howler and Bush Pipit share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Chordata. (Chordates)
